Read our full ranking methodologyHow to Choose the Right Dentist in Northampton
Check credentials and experience
Confirm the dentist is licensed and look at how long the practice has served Northampton. Years in practice and clear credentials such as DDS or DMD are a strong signal of consistent care.
Read recent patient reviews
Reviews reveal what it is really like to be a patient, from wait times to how comfortable procedures feel. Look for a steady pattern of positive feedback rather than a single glowing note.
Match services to your needs
If you want cosmetic work, implants, or braces, choose a Northampton practice that offers those services in house so your care stays coordinated under one roof.
Ask about insurance and payment
Call ahead to confirm the office accepts your plan and offers payment options. Many Northampton practices work with major insurers and provide financing for larger treatments.
Visit for a first appointment
A cleaning or consultation is the best way to judge cleanliness, technology, and how well the team listens. Trust your comfort level with both the dentist and the staff.
What to Expect at Your First Visit in Northampton
A first visit to a Northampton dental office is mostly about getting to know your mouth. You will typically get a cleaning, an exam, and a clear explanation of anything that needs attention. You leave with a written plan, an estimate for any work, and a recommended schedule for the next visit.
Dental Costs and Insurance in Northampton
Dental costs in Northampton vary by treatment and by whether you have insurance. A routine checkup and cleaning is usually the most affordable visit, while crowns, implants, and orthodontics cost more and are often spread over several appointments. Most practices accept major dental insurance and many offer payment plans or membership options for patients without coverage, so it is worth asking about pricing before you book.
Questions to Ask a Northampton Dentist
A short list of questions saves time and money when choosing a dentist in Northampton.
- ✓Do you accept my dental insurance, and can you estimate my out of pocket cost before treatment?
- ✓What are your options for patients without insurance, such as membership plans or financing?
- ✓How do you handle dental emergencies and after hours care?
- ✓Which services do you provide in house, and what would you refer out to a specialist?
- ✓What technology do you use for X rays, and how do you keep radiation exposure low?
- ✓Can you walk me through the treatment plan and any alternatives before we start?
